Results Before technical reformation, tested in 18 weld working posts, the over-standard rate of weld fume concentration (total dust) in workplaces was 94.4% . The maximum value of short term exposure limit(STEL) was 36.0 mg/m3, exceeding the standard by 5.0 times.
After technical reformation, 40 weld working posts were tested and the average STEL and TWA of weld fume decreased from 15.7 mg/m3 and 13.6 mg/m3 to 3.6 mg/m3 and 2.6 mg/m3 respectively, the exceeding rate of weld fume concentration (total dust) in the workplaces dropping from 94.4% to 15.0%.
